Lesley Scally Posted November 23, 2007 Report Share Posted November 23, 2007 Well we didn't quite need the sun block this weekend!! Although Donald and I did still hang around the bus shelter underneath the Erskine Bridge in the hope of finding some rays whilst waiting for the bunch to pass - only to later find out that the rest of the bunch were swiftly at the Bowling road end!!! David, Chung, Mike and Frank (sorry if I missed anyone) set off from the Clubrooms on route to Helensburgh. Having missed them at the Bridge, Donald and I managed to get a tow along with some of the Inverclyde boys heading for a day out round Dunoon. We left them somewhere around Dumbarton and proceeded to timetrial to catch the rest of the JWCC - well Donald did, I was just trying to hand on!! Finally we caught them leaving Cardross. Continued on our way to Helensburgh and then over Sinclair Street, back through Balloch and Alexandria, opting not to stop for a cafe stop this time (maybe next time Chung). Only got caught in a few spots of rain in Helensburgh, other than that we were really lucky with the weather. Great sociable ride at a nice steady pace.
